Mini-review. Vitamin D for the prevention of type 2 diabetes: Evidence and implications

Prediabetes affects hundreds of millions of people worldwide and serving as a gateway to type 2 diabetes. While lifestyle change remains the foundation of prevention, it is difficult to sustain at scale, and many people continue to progress despite best efforts. This has led researchers to ask whether there are additional, practical tools that can help shift risk earlier and more broadly.

Over the past decade, evidence for vitamin D has matured from biological plausibility and observational associations to randomized clinical trials. Across multiple large studies and confirmed in meta-analyses, vitamin D supplementation produces a modest but consistent reduction in the risk of developing diabetes and increases the likelihood of returning to normal glucose levels. These effects appear stronger in individuals with lower vitamin D levels and may depend on achieving sufficient circulating levels over time.

Taken together, the evidence points to a clear conclusion. In a field where many effective interventions are difficult to implement broadly, vitamin D stands out as a practical addition. The opportunity now is not to wait for perfect evidence, but to thoughtfully integrate what we already know into care, using vitamin D as one more tool to bend the trajectory of diabetes at the population level.
